CVE-2025-12357 International Standards Organization ISO 15118-2 Improper Restriction of Communication Channel to Intended Endpoints

By manipulating the Signal Level Attenuation Characterization SLAC protocol with spoofed measurements, an attacker can stage a man-in-the-middle attack between an electric vehicle and chargers that comply with the ISO 15118-2 part. This vulnerability may be exploitable wirelessly, within close...

StarCharge Artemis AC Charger 安全漏洞

StarCharge Artemis AC Charger is an AC charger from StarCharge Singapore. A security vulnerability exists in the StarCharge Artemis AC Charger version 7-22 kW 1.0.4, which originates from a stack overflow in the cgiMain function in download.cgi, which could lead to the execution of arbitrary code...
